Meeting discusses foreign investment in Pakistani startup ecosystem. Adviser to the Prime Minister on Finance and Revenue Dr Abdul Hafeez Shaikh chaired.

The investors from Thrive Capital, a New York based venture capital firm with over $ 2 billion invested in assets under management specially attended. 

Tania Aidrus, Chief Digital Pakistan, Dr Reza Baqir Governor State Bank of Pakistan and Secretary Finance Naveed Kamran Baloch also attended.

Furthermore, they discussed ways and means for enhancing foreign investment in Pakistani startup ecosystem.

Representatives from the Thrive Capital expressed desire to invest in the Pakistani startup ecosystem. During the meeting they said that their investment aimed at putting local start ups on the map.
